Part of the problem is that the LCC airlines have set themselves up in such a way as that you may not remember to check BA's prices, or if you do you'll do it via someone like Expedia who will also present you with prices for a lot of competitors.

Of course the other thing to bear in mind is that the nature of BA's route network makes them irrelevant to the type of traveller that a lot of young people outside London will most frequently be. If you're looking for a weekend break from the regions to [I don't really care; somewhere hot / a nice city / somewhere with cheap beer] then you will start by looking to see where Ryanair / EasyJet / Wizz / Jet2 fly to from airports convenient to you. With statistically insignificant exceptions BA do not offer these flights; they only offer the type of flights you'd been needing if you were going somewhere for work.
